Just days after landing a commitment from four-star quarterback Tray Bishop, Auburn stays hot on the recruiting trail and landed a commit of four-star running back prospect Devan Barrett Thursday.

Following Barrett’s commitment, Auburn now has 13 total prospect lined up to join the school’s 2017 recruiting class.
